command similar to setdiff for case insensitive

13 次查看(过去 30 天)
Is there any command similar to setdiff for case insensitive. As setdiff is case sensitive?
for example a = {'car','book,'glass'}
b = {'CAr','book','glass'}
c = setdiff(a,b)
returns the same array a(because setdiff does not work for car insensitive)
how can i do this? because i have two cell array which is really large.
running in loop by strcmpi and finding the index will take some time.
is it possible to excute in single command as like setdiff?
Thank you

采纳的回答

Titus Edelhofer
Titus Edelhofer 2015-6-25
Hi,
if two commands is fine as well, you can do the following:
% find index of elements in a that are in b:
[flag,idx] = ismember(lower(a), lower(b));
% remove the found elements:
a(idx(flag)) = [];
